What Causes Rollover Accidents?

Rollover accidents can have numerous causes. However, most rollover accidents are caused by:

  • Driver negligence. When motorists drive aggressively, distracted, fatigued, or under the influence of alcohol or drugs, they significantly increase the risk of a rollover accident. High speeds, abrupt lane changes, hitting curbs, and colliding with other vehicles or items can quickly cause a car or truck to become unstable and roll over. 
  • Equipment failure. If a tire blows out, brakes fail, or other equipment malfunctions, it can cause a vehicle to become unbalanced and roll over. These problems may be caused by defective or negligently maintained parts and equipment. 
  • Poor road conditions. Some roads are designed in a dangerous manner, and others are negligently maintained. These conditions can contribute to a rollover accident.
  • Overloaded or improperly secured cargo. Rollover accidents can be caused by overloaded trucks or when their cargo is not correctly loaded and secured.

Who Is Liable For Rollover Accident Damages?

Liability depends on the cause of your accident. Some potentially liable parties in a rollover accident include negligent drivers, manufacturers of defective or dangerous equipment, and maintenance and repair companies.

Other liable parties may include trucking companies, cargo loading entities, government entities responsible for maintaining roads that are dangerous or negligently maintained, and employers of drivers who were on the job at the time of the accident. 

Rollover Accident Injuries

Rollover accidents can be fatal or cause life-altering injuries. Some of the most common injuries sustained in a rollover accident include:

  • Traumatic brain injuries (TBIs).
  • Spinal cord injuries.
  • Internal bleeding and organ damage.
  • Crushed and broken bones.
  • Scarring and disfigurement.
  • Post-traumatic stress disorder.

Compensation For Rollover Accident Injuries

The amount and type of compensation you can recover depend on the specific facts of your case. You may be able to recover economic damages, including medical expenses, lost wages, property damage, and other financial costs and losses. 

You may also be able to recover non-economic damages such as pain and suffering, mental and emotional distress, disfigurement, loss of enjoyment of life, and other intangible costs and losses.
